负载均衡服务器是什么意思,深度解析负载均衡服务器,原理、应用与未来发展趋势
- 综合资讯
- 2024-12-03 22:19:55
- 4

负载均衡服务器是一种分散请求到多个服务器以优化资源利用和响应速度的技术。其原理是通过算法将请求分发到不同的服务器,提高系统稳定性和性能。应用广泛,如电商平台、在线教育等...
负载均衡服务器是一种分散请求到多个服务器以优化资源利用和响应速度的技术。其原理是通过算法将请求分发到不同的服务器,提高系统稳定性和性能。应用广泛,如电商平台、在线教育等。未来发展趋势将朝着智能化、自动化方向发展,实现更高效的服务。
随着互联网技术的飞速发展,网站和应用的数量和规模不断扩大,用户对网络服务的质量要求也越来越高,负载均衡服务器作为一种重要的网络技术,在保证网络服务质量、提高资源利用率、优化用户体验等方面发挥着至关重要的作用,本文将从负载均衡服务器的定义、原理、应用及未来发展趋势等方面进行深入探讨。
负载均衡服务器定义
负载均衡服务器(Load Balancer Server)是一种网络设备或软件,通过对多个服务器进行资源分配,实现流量的均匀分配,从而提高整个系统的处理能力和可用性,负载均衡服务器可以解决单点故障、提高资源利用率、优化用户体验等问题。
负载均衡服务器原理
1、工作模式
负载均衡服务器主要分为以下三种工作模式:
(1)轮询(Round Robin):按照一定顺序将请求分配给各个服务器,每个服务器处理相同数量的请求。
(2)最少连接(Least Connections):将请求分配给连接数最少的服务器,以减少服务器的连接压力。
(3)源地址哈希(Source IP Hash):根据客户端的IP地址进行哈希计算,将请求分配给对应的服务器。
2、负载均衡算法
负载均衡服务器常用的算法包括以下几种:
(1)轮询算法:将请求均匀分配给各个服务器,实现负载均衡。
(2)最少连接算法:将请求分配给连接数最少的服务器,提高服务器利用率。
(3)源地址哈希算法:根据客户端IP地址进行哈希计算,将请求分配给对应的服务器,提高请求处理速度。
(4)最少响应时间算法:将请求分配给响应时间最短的服务器,提高用户体验。
(5)权重轮询算法:根据服务器权重将请求分配给对应的服务器,实现动态负载均衡。
负载均衡服务器应用
1、网站应用
负载均衡服务器在网站应用中具有重要作用,可以解决以下问题:
(1)提高网站并发处理能力,应对大量访问。
(2)解决单点故障,提高网站可用性。
(3)优化用户体验,降低延迟。
2、数据库应用
负载均衡服务器在数据库应用中具有重要作用,可以解决以下问题:
(1)提高数据库并发处理能力,应对大量查询。
(2)实现读写分离,提高数据库性能。
(3)优化数据存储和访问,提高资源利用率。
3、实时通信应用
负载均衡服务器在实时通信应用中具有重要作用,可以解决以下问题:
(1)提高实时通信系统的并发处理能力,应对大量用户。
(2)解决单点故障,提高系统可用性。
(3)优化用户体验,降低延迟。
负载均衡服务器未来发展趋势
1、软硬件结合
随着云计算、大数据等技术的发展,负载均衡服务器将逐渐从纯软件向软硬件结合方向发展,提高处理能力和性能。
2、智能化
未来负载均衡服务器将具备智能化特点,能够根据实时流量、服务器性能等因素自动调整负载均衡策略,实现动态负载均衡。
3、安全性
随着网络安全问题的日益突出,负载均衡服务器将更加注重安全性,提高防御能力,防止攻击。
4、灵活性
未来负载均衡服务器将具备更高的灵活性,支持多种协议和应用场景,满足不同用户需求。
负载均衡服务器在提高网络服务质量、优化用户体验、提高资源利用率等方面发挥着重要作用,随着互联网技术的不断发展,负载均衡服务器将朝着智能化、安全性、灵活性等方向发展,为用户提供更加优质的服务。
本文链接:https://www.zhitaoyun.cn/1297509.html
发表评论